Whithorn is a Royal Burgh about 10 miles south of Wigtown, the county town of Wigtownshire. Whithorn was the location of the first recorded Christian church in Scotland, built by Saint Ninian around 397 ad.
The Isle of Whithorn (3 miles) is a popular coastal tourist destination. Every year sees a pilgrimage to nearby St Ninian’s Cave and you can learn the story of the town at Whithorn Priory & Museum.
Whithorn’s town centre retains its street plan from the Middle Ages with a wide market square and long garden plots. Many Kings and Queens journeyed to this small town over the centuries. A few miles away, the Isle of Whithorn enjoys a picturesque seaside setting and down by the harbour is St Ninian’s Chapel.
The Machars area is a popular area for those who partake in outdoor pursuits such as cycling, walking, fishing and bird watching.
